About The Last Dance: A Novel Of The 87th Precinct
A man with no enemies is found hanging. Carella and Brown soon discover that he could not possibly have hanged himself. The investigation takes them into the politics and passions of a musical in preparation. Or rather two: one that happened 50 years ago and one that is happening now.
